What the ingredient list tells us

Original label (source language)

Poitrine de poulet (80%), eau, fécule de pomme de terre, sel, épices (contient du céleri), protéine de soja, maltodextrine, dextrose, épaississant: E407, conservateurs: E326, E262, E250, stabilisant: E451i, amidon modifié: E1442, antioxygène: E316. Allergènes : contient du soja et du céleri. Peut contenir de la moutarde.

How our indicator is calculated

When available, Nutri-Score A–E maps to 92, 74, 55, 34 or 16 points. With NOVA present, we combine 80% of those points with 20% of the processing indicator (100, 82, 52 or 16 for groups 1–4). Without NOVA we use the nutrition points alone. Without a usable Nutri-Score, we do not rate the product. This is a simplified comparison aid, not a validated health assessment.

Does “may contain” make it non-vegan?

A precautionary trace statement describes possible cross-contact, not an ingredient intentionally included in the recipe. We keep it separate from the recipe assessment. This distinction does not establish allergy safety.

Is the nutrition rating the same as the vegan result?

No. Vegan status concerns ingredient origin. Nutri-Score describes a nutrition profile, NOVA describes processing, and the Veganory score is our own combination of available indicators. A vegan result does not mean a food is nutritionally balanced.
